PMS 227 U is a Pantone PMS color identified within the Pantone Matching System and commonly specified for brand-controlled visual environments. It conveys a vivid, dramatic, high-energy impression with an intense and expressive presence.

The color appears very dark in value, with a low Light Reflectance Value of 9.01. It reads as warm and red-forward, with high saturation and a subtle blue-red undertone that can deepen under neutral lighting. Finish choice can influence perceived intensity, with higher sheens increasing contrast.

PMS 227 U works well in brand-facing displays, signage, and marketing installations where strong color presence is intentional. Because of its depth and saturation, a light or appropriately tinted primer can help improve coverage and uniformity. Lighting and finish selection should be evaluated with a real paint sample to confirm appearance.

Similar colors:
PMS 226 U: slightly lighter and more open, with increased brightness and less visual density.
PMS 228 U: darker and heavier, with reduced vibrancy and a more subdued magenta presence.
PMS 234 U: cooler and slightly more purple-leaning, with less red warmth.

Frequently Asked Questions About Pantone™ PMS 227 U

What does the name PMS 227 U mean, and how should I order it correctly?

PMS 227 U is a specific Pantone Matching System color code. The number 227 identifies the color target, and the suffix U means it was originally defined on uncoated paper.

When ordering paint, always reference the full code PMS 227 U, not just a color name. Pantone names can be informal, but the code and suffix are what define the intended standard. Omitting the U or substituting a different suffix can result in a noticeably different match.

How does sheen selection affect the appearance of PMS 227 U paint?

Sheen has a direct impact on how PMS 227 U is perceived. Higher sheen finishes tend to look darker and more saturated, while lower sheen finishes can appear slightly lighter and less intense.

Choose sheen based on viewing distance, substrate, and how critical color intensity is for your application. If brand approval is required, it is best to evaluate PMS 227 U in the actual sheen on the intended surface before committing to full production.

How accurate can a paint match be for a saturated color like PMS 227 U?

PMS 227 U is a vivid, saturated Pantone color, which makes accurate matching more challenging than neutral tones. Differences in substrate, sheen, and lighting can all influence the final appearance.

MyPerfectColor produces paint matched to the Pantone PMS target, but minor visual variation is normal across materials. For high-visibility or brand-critical projects, ordering a sample to review PMS 227 U under actual lighting and conditions is strongly recommended.

What surface preparation is recommended before applying PMS 227 U matched paint?

Proper surface preparation helps PMS 227 U appear consistent and uniform. Surfaces should be clean, dry, and free of dust, oils, or residues that could interfere with adhesion.

On smooth or glossy substrates, light scuffing may improve bonding. Because saturated colors like PMS 227 U can have lower hide, applying a test area first allows you to confirm coverage and appearance before completing the project.

Can I use the Pantone PMS 227 U for touch up?

Unfortunately, no.

Some manufacturers specify Pantone colors as touch up for their products, but Pantone does not work well as a proxy for a touch-up solution (for a litany of reasons such as it doesn't include sheen and Pantone color tolerances are not tight enough for touch up). When we match Pantone colors we are matching to a swatch in a Pantone book - not to your product.

The only way we can provide a touch-up solution for your product is for you send us a part. We would use the part to create a touch-up grade match. Unfortunately, there isn't an effective way to 'spec' the color well enough to produce a touch up without the part.

How much area will one spray can cover? And what is Pantone PMS 227 U spray paint made of?

To make spray paint matched to Pantone PMS 227 U. MyPerfectColor uses an acrylic enamel which is a fast-drying durable coating suitable for interior or exterior use. MyPerfectColor custom spray paint enables you to conveniently achieve a professional spray-smooth finish in any color in any sheen. It sticks well to most surfaces including metal, plastics, powder-coatings, cabinets and primed or previously painted wood.

The 11oz spray will cover about 20 square feet per coat. Keep in mind that it is difficult to gauge how much spray you'll need as it is highly dependent on how it is applied. It is better to have too much than run short.

How do I convert PMS 227 U to a different color from another paint company?

While MyPerfectColor can provide PMS 227 U in paint, we don't provide any crossover information. We've found that every paint company offers its own unique selection of colors and rarely does a color have an exact equivalent in another company's color collection, especially for a color collection like Pantone which is designed for bright colors and inks.
